How Gateway is distinct from Routers?
Answer: The gateway functions at the upper levels of OSI model and translates information among two completely distinct network architectures or data formats.

Beaconing: It is an FDDI frame or Token Ring frame which points to serious trouble with the ring, like a broken cable. The beacon frame brings the address of the station considered to be down.
